As a Tax Consultant on our Credits & Incentives team, you will be responsible for pursuing federal, state, and local statutory and discretionary tax savings opportunities, tracking savings, maintaining incentive compliance to avoid recapture and responding to audits. This role also supports the Tax team with income tax provision and workpaper preparation. Responsibilities include:
- Identifying available incentives via tax research engines, including state and local tax incentives for new facilities, jobs credits, port credits, environmental credits, training credits, enterprise zone credits, energy incentives, federal hurricane credits, federal retention credits, new market tax credits, federal opportunity zones, and maximizing tax deductions such as inventory donations
- Engaging with economic development professionals, consultants, and government officials in the negotiations of state and local discretionary tax savings opportunities for new projects
- Monitoring legislative changes that could affect current or future incentive projects
- Preparing ongoing incentive compliance to ensure continuation of benefits
- Managing the Work Opportunity Tax Credit (WOTC) program and credit calculations
- Assisting with the preparation of the annual federal and state income tax return workpapers, including tax credit and permanent deduction calculations
- Assisting with the calculation of tax credits and permanent deduction estimates for the quarterly income tax provision
- Ensuring accuracy related to various cash management functions
